Definition of EXCITED
verb
-
To stir the emotions of.
"The fireworks which opened the festivities excited anyone present."
-
To arouse or bring out (e.g. feelings); to stimulate.
"Favoritism tends to excite jealousy in the ones not being favored."
-
To cause an electron to move to a higher than normal state; to promote an electron to an outer level.
"By applying electric potential to the neon atoms, the electrons become excited, then emit a photon when returning to normal."
adjective
-
Having great enthusiasm.
"He was very excited about his promotion."
-
Being in a state of higher energy.
"The excited electrons give off light when they drop to a lower energy state."
-
Having an erection; erect.
